History of the iPad

Apple began developing the tablet back in 1983. But then the information was classified, and was leaked to the general public only in 2002.

The consumer was waiting for a miracle, since the concept of the device promised a lot. But the expectations dragged on for another 4 years, when the developer has already officially announced the development of a tablet with a touch screen. The approximate date of entry into the market - 2007 - was also named then. However, the iPad of the first line was released only in 2010. The product was presented by the head of Apple himself.

As expected, the device aroused increased interest. In the first day, more than 300 thousand units of the product were sold, and more than a million programs created for the tablet were downloaded from the store. In just under a month, one million copies were sold.

A year later, the "apple" company presented the second line. Its representatives have become thinner, sleeker, lighter. Sales were up again.

A year later, the release of third-generation tablets followed, and so on.

Dimensions and memory

Let's take a closer look, what are the main differences between the iPod and iPad?

First of all, it is the weight and size. So, the iPad can be up to 24.28 cm high, 18.97 cm wide and 0.134 cm thick. Its weight is from 0.68 to 0.73 kg. In turn, iPod "Classic" has a height of 10.35 cm, a width of 6.18 cm and 0.1 cm thick. Weight - 140 g. Other devices, for example, Nano, weigh even less.


Naturally, the player differs from the tablet not only in purpose, but also in the amount of memory for storing various information. So, the amount of permanent memory in the iPad can be 16.32 or 64 GB, while the classic iPod can have a hard drive up to 160 GB. In some models, the differences may be insignificant (from 2 to 4 GB). Output and Input The iPad has a 30-pin dock connector, a headphone output, a built-in speaker, a microphone, and, on select models, a SIM card slot. Therefore, speaking about the difference between the iPad and the iPod, it is worth pointing out that the classic model has only headphone jacks and a docking station.

Display, runtime and device capabilities

Let's turn our attention to the display of these two devices. On the iPad, it can be as large as 9.7 inches, LED-backlit, and widescreen glossy. The iPod, unlike it, has a simpler option - a color LCD display with LED backlighting.

As for the power, it turned out that the iPad is equipped with an internal lithium-polymer battery that can work for about 10 hours on a single charge, while the players have a lithium-ion battery, whose battery life is approximately 30 hours. Charging time may vary between 3-4 hours.


Now about the presence of wireless communication. The iPad is available with Wi-Fi, Bluetooth and EDR technology for wireless and headphone connectivity, or Wi-Fi + 3G for faster access to the World Wide Web or GPS. The difference between these options is only in the wireless connection to the Network.
